What Are Egg Moves

Egg moves in Pokémon Scarlet and Violet are known as special moves that cannot be learned with the help of a Technical Machine (TM) or by leveling up. Instead, they are learned with the help of a Pokémon who already has them in its arsenal of movesets. There are two ways you could get them in the game, and shortly we’ll be discussing how.

One example of an Egg Move is the Belly Drum which can be taught to Azumarill with the help of a Pokémon who already knows the Belly Drum move. While the move is a pretty crucial weapon in Azumarill’s movesets, the Pokémon can’t learn it normally as it can do with the other moves it naturally has.

How To Get Egg Moves Through Breeding 

Breeding is the old way to get a Pokémon Egg Moves. For that, you’ll need a male and female Pokémon from the same Egg group. The male will pass on the moves, while the female will determine the species of your newborn Pokémon.

You can also get yourself either a male or female Pokémon with the Egg Move you want to inherit and have the Pokémon called Ditto with you. Ditto can shapeshift into any Pokémon and breed, so you won’t have to get into the hassle of finding a Pokémon from the same Egg group.

Once you have the right Pokémons, simply start the picnic, and at the end of the picnic, your Pokémons will have laid the egg in the basket. Hatch it, and you’ll have the offspring Pokémon who will also have the Egg Move you were looking for.

How To Get Egg Moves In Pokémon Scarlet And Violet Through Mirror Herb

The Mirror Herb way is the updated and more fast way to get Egg Moves in Pokémon Scarlet and Violet. With it, you just need to find a Pokémon that has an Egg Move that you want your Pokémon to have.

If you don’t know how to teach your Pokémon Egg Moves in the game, there’s no need to fret. The process is relatively straightforward. Just follow these steps, and at the end of them, your Pokémon will have learned them:

  1. Go to Delibird Presents and get yourself a Mirror Herb. It will cost 30000 Pokédollars.
  2. Keep the Pokémon that has the Egg Move and the Pokémon you want to learn the move in your party.
  3. Hand over the Mirror Herb to the Pokémon you want to teach the Egg Move to
  4. Initiate a Picnic.
  5. The desired move will be passed on to the Pokémon.
  6. If you replace the Egg move with another move, the former will no longer be on the Pokémon’s move list, so you will have to learn it again.

Unable To Teach Pokémon Egg Moves In Pokémon Scarlet And Violet

If you’ve been unable to teach your Pokémon Egg Moves in Pokémon Scarlet and Violet, there can possibly be two reasons for this. The first one might be that the Pokémon you want to teach the move to has no empty slot to learn any new moves. So before you start a Picnic, make sure to make room for a new move.

The second reason might be that your Pokémon cannot learn a certain Egg Move. Not every Pokémon can learn Egg Moves, and some Pokémons can learn only particular Egg Moves.
